img{
	border:none;
}
h1,h2,h3,h4,h5,h6{
	padding:0px;
	margin:0px;
	font-weight:normal;
}
body{
	padding:0px;
	margin:8px 0px 0px 0px;
	font-family: Arial, Verdana, Sans-serif;
	font-size:12px;
	color:#333333;
	background:#ffffff url(../images/bodybg.png) repeat-x top left;
}
.container{
	width:890px;
	margin:0px auto;
	overflow:auto;
}
.header{
	height:117px;
}
.header .logo{
	margin-top:2px;
	float:left;
}
.header .consult{
	float:right;
	height:78px;
	padding:12px 15px 0px 0px;
}
.header .consult h2{
	font-size:20px;
	color:#5e7a40;
}
.header .consult h2.phone{
	color:#000000;
	font-size:32px;
}
.header ul{
	clear:both;
	padding:0px;
	margin:0px;
	list-style-type:none;
	height:27px;
	background-color:#859e76;
}
.header ul li{
	float:left;
}
.header ul li a:link,.header ul li a:visited{
	line-height:27px;
	color:#ffffff;
	padding:0px 9px;
	font-family:Arial, Verdana, Sans-serif;
	font-size:12px;
	font-weight:bold;
	text-decoration:none;
}
.header ul li a:hover{
	color: #e6e6e7;
}
.content{
	width:100%;
	overflow:auto;
	background:	url(../images/containerbg.png) repeat-y top left;
	padding-bottom:15px;
}

/* --- SIDEBAR --- */
.sidebar{
	width:308px;
	float:left;
	background:#e1e7db;
}
.sidebar .box{
	width:274px;
	padding:10px;
	border:7px solid #677b53;
	background:#ffffff;
}
.sidebar h2{
	color:#000000;
	font-family:"Arial Narrow", Arial, Sans-serif;
	font-size:18px;
	font-weight:normal;
	padding:0px 0px 5px 0px;
}
.sidebar a:link,.sidebar a:visited{
	font-family:"Arial Narrow",Arial, Sans-serif;
	font-size:14px;
	font-weight:bold;
	display:block;
	text-decoration:none;
	color:#000000;
	padding-left:15px;
	margin:7px 0px;
}
.sidebar a:hover{
	color:#251375;
}
.sidebar a.med{
	background:url('../images/arrow.png') no-repeat 0px 5px;
}
.caseFormTitle{
	font-family:"Arial Narrow", Arial, Sans-serif;
	font-size:16px;
	color:#637a44;
	text-align:center;
	padding:0px 5px;
}
form{
	border:none;
	background-color:#eef1ea;
	width:290px;
	margin:0px auto;
	padding:20px 0px;
}
fieldset{
	border:none;
	padding:0px 10px;
}
label{
	display:block;
	clear:left;
	float:left;
	width:100px;
	padding-right:10px;
	margin:3px 0px;
	text-align:left;
}
input{
	margin:3px 0px;
}
.noLabel{
	margin-left:110px;
}
.fullWidth{
	width:255px;
}
.topLabel{
	width:245px;
	text-align:left;
}
textarea{
	height:70px;
	width:255px;
    overflow:auto;
}
a.email{
	display:inline !important;
	font-size:12px !important;
	color:#555555 !important;
	padding-left:20px !important;
	background:url('../images/email.png') no-repeat left center;
}
a.print{
	display:inline !important;
	font-size:12px !important;
	color:#555555 !important;
	padding-left:20px !important;
	background:url('../images/print.png') no-repeat left center;
}
/* --- MAIN CONTENT ON RIGHT SIDE --- */
.mainContent{
	float:right;
	text-align:left;
	min-height:500px;
	width:560px;
	margin-top:10px;
	padding-left:20px;
}
.mainContent ol li{
margin-bottom:15px;
}
h1.pageTitle{
	font-size:14px;
	font-weight:bold;
	line-height:31px;
	color: #505a66;
}
h1.pageTitle a 
{
	color: #505a66 !important;
	font-weight: bold !important;
	cursor:default !important;
	text-decoration:none !important;
}
.mainContent h4{
	padding:10px 0px 0px 0px;
	font-weight:bold;
}
.mainContent ul li{
	list-style-image:url('../images/sarrow.png');
}
.mainContent a:link,.mainContent a:visited{
	color: #3e3b7e;
	text-decoration: none;
	font-weight:bold;
}
.mainContent a:hover{
	text-decoration: underline;
}
.mainContent img.banner{
	display:block;
	padding:2px 0px;
	margin:5px 0px 10px 0px;
	/*border-top:1px solid #cccecb;
	border-bottom:1px solid #cccecb;*/
}
h2.callus{
	font-family:"Arial Narrow", Arial, Sans-serif;
	font-size:21px;
	font-weight:normal;
	color:#3e2e85;
	text-align:center;
	padding:30px 0px 20px 0px;
}
h2.callus strong{
	font-size:25px;
	font-weight:normal;
	color:#5e5e5e;
	padding-left:7px;
	border-left:1px solid #b5da99;
}
h3{
	font-family: Arial, Sans-serif;
	font-size:16px;
	font-weight:normal;
	text-align:left;
	padding:10px 0px 00px 0px;
}
/* ---  FOOTER --- */
.footer{
	clear:both;
	padding:10px 20px;
	background-color:#b5b3bb;
	font-family: Arial, Verdana, Sans-serif;
	color:#ffffff;
}
.footer ul{
	margin:0px auto;
	padding:10px 0px;
	list-style-type:none;
	text-align:center;
}
.footer ul li{
	display:inline;
	border-left:1px solid #b5da99;
}
.footer ul li.first-child{
	border-left:none;
}
.footer ul li a:link,.footer ul li a:visited{
	padding:0px 3px;
	color:#ffffff;
	font-weight:bold;
	text-decoration:none;
}
.footer ul li a:hover{
	text-decoration:underline;
}
.footer .fcontent{
	width:890px;
	margin:0px auto;
}
.footer p{
	margin:0px;
	padding:5px 0px;
}
.footer a:link,.footer a:visited{
	color:#ffffff;
}
.footer a:hover{
	color:#8b7ad5;
}
.dropmenudiv{
	position:absolute;
	top: 0px;
	border: 3px solid #677c53; /*THEME CHANGE HERE*/
	border-top-width: 0px;
	font:normal 12px Verdana;
	line-height:18px;
	z-index:100;
	background-color: white;
	width: 250px;
	visibility: hidden;
	/*filter: progid:DXImageTransform.Microsoft.Shadow(color=#CACACA,direction=135,strength=4);*/
	text-align:left;
	font-size:0.8em;
}
.dropmenudiv a{
	width: auto;
	display: block;
	text-indent: 3px;
	/*border-bottom: 1px solid #d3d3d3;*/ /*THEME CHANGE HERE*/
	padding: 2px 0;
	background-color:#f8f8f8;
	text-decoration: none;
	color: #677c53;
	font-family: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
}
* html .dropmenudiv a{ /*IE only hack*/
	width: 100%;
}
.dropmenudiv a:hover{ /*THEME CHANGE HERE*/
	background-color: #ffffff;
	text-decoration:underline;
}

/*********** #Print/Email This Page ***********/

#email-print {
	width: 290px;
	padding: 10px 0px 30px 0px;
    margin:0 10px 10px 9px;
	line-height: 20px;
	font-size: 10px;
	text-align: left;
	background-color: #eef1ea;
}

#email-print a {
	display: block;
	text-decoration: none;
	color: #555555;
    font-family: Arial,Sans-serif;
    font-size:10px;
    padding-left:0;
}

#email-print a:hover {
	color:#777777;
}

#email-text {
	width: 100px;
	padding: 0px 0px 0px 20px;
	background: url("http://www.child-disability-attorneys.com/images/email.png") no-repeat left center;
	margin: 0px 0px 0px 20px;
}

#print-text {
	width: 115px;
	padding: 0px 0px 0px 20px;
	background: url("http://www.child-disability-attorneys.com/images/print.png") no-repeat 1px center;
	float:right;
	margin:0;
}
a.featured{
	padding-left:15px;
	background:url('../images/barrow2.png') no-repeat top left;
	font-weight:bold;
	color:#e36904 !important;
}